Federal Judge Clears Path For GTCR's Takeover Of Surmodics After FTC Challenge
Benzinga· 2025-11-11 17:00
Group 1 - The U.S. District Court for the Northern District of Illinois denied a request by the FTC and state regulators for a preliminary injunction against the acquisition of Surmodics Inc. by GTCR, marking a significant step toward completing the merger [1][2] - GTCR agreed to acquire Surmodics for approximately $627 million, or $43 per share, with the CEO of Surmodics expressing confidence in the merger's potential benefits for stakeholders [2][5] - The FTC challenged the acquisition due to GTCR's investment in Biocoat Inc., raising concerns about competition in the hydrophilic coatings market [3][4] Group 2 - The FTC's complaint highlighted that creating hydrophilic coatings requires specialized expertise and significant investment, making it unlikely for new competitors to emerge post-merger [4] - Surmodics disagreed with the FTC's decision and emphasized its commitment to completing the merger, asserting that it would benefit shareholders, customers, and patients [4][5] - Surmodics shares experienced a significant increase of 49.93%, reaching a new 52-week high of $40.99 at the time of publication [5]
Surmodics Announces U.S. District Court Denies Request for Preliminary Injunction to Block Proposed Acquisition by GTCR
Businesswire· 2025-11-11 00:00
Core Viewpoint - The U.S. District Court has denied the FTC's request for a preliminary injunction to block the proposed acquisition of Surmodics by GTCR, marking a significant step towards the completion of the merger [1][3]. Group 1: Merger Details - The consummation of the merger is still subject to a Temporary Restraining Order, which prevents the parties from finalizing the merger before 5:00 p.m. Central time on November 17 [2]. - The merger agreement includes conditions such as the absence of any legal restraints, no material adverse effect on the company, and other customary closing conditions [2]. Group 2: Company Background - Surmodics is a leading provider of medical device and in vitro diagnostic technologies, focusing on performance coating technologies for intravascular medical devices and components for diagnostic tests [4]. - The company's mission is to improve disease detection and treatment, leveraging its expertise in surface modification and drug-delivery coating technologies [4].

SRDX Stock Up Following Q3 Earnings Beat, Gross Margin Contracts
ZACKS· 2025-08-12 18:06
Core Insights - Surmodics, Inc. (SRDX) reported adjusted earnings per share (EPS) of 6 cents for Q3 fiscal 2025, a significant improvement from a loss of 27 cents in the same quarter last year and better than the Zacks Consensus Estimate of a loss of 21 cents [1] - The company’s total revenues for the quarter were $29.6 million, reflecting a year-over-year decline of 2.6%, but exceeding the Zacks Consensus Estimate by 4.3% [2][4] - Surmodics has revised its fiscal 2025 revenue guidance, now expecting total revenues between $116.5 million and $118.5 million, which indicates a decrease of 8-6% compared to the previous fiscal year [12][13] Revenue Analysis - Total revenues included $0.0 million from SurVeil drug-coated balloon (DCB) license fees, down from $1.1 million in Q3 fiscal 2024, attributed to the completion of the TRANSCEND clinical trial [2][4] - Excluding SurVeil DCB license fees, total revenues increased by 1% year-over-year to $29.6 million [3] - The Medical Device segment reported sales of $22.2 million, a decrease of 4.9% from the previous year, while In Vitro Diagnostics (IVD) sales improved by 5.7% to $7.4 million [5][6] Segment Performance - Product sales were $16.8 million, down 4.6% year-over-year, while royalties and license fees totaled $9.7 million, a decline of 7.7% [7] - Research, development, and other revenues increased by 35.7% to $3.1 million [8] - The decrease in SurVeil DCB product sales revenues was $1.7 million year-over-year, primarily due to lower demand from Abbott, Surmodics' exclusive distribution partner [4] Margin and Expense Trends - Gross profit decreased by 4.1% year-over-year to $20.9 million, with a gross margin contraction of 116 basis points to 70.9% [9] - Selling, general, and administrative expenses rose by 6.8% to $17.8 million, while research and development expenses fell by 22.4% to $7.6 million [10] Financial Position - Surmodics ended Q3 fiscal 2025 with cash and cash equivalents of $26.3 million, down from $29.2 million at the end of the previous quarter [11] - Total long-term debt slightly increased to $29.67 million from $29.63 million [11] Future Guidance - The company anticipates a decrease of $3.6 million in SurVeil DCB license fee revenues for fiscal 2025, with no further recognition of these revenues after March 31, 2025 [14] - Adjusted loss per share for fiscal 2025 is now projected to be between 35 and 20 cents, an improvement from the previous outlook of 62 to 42 cents [15]
SurModics (SRDX) Q3 Earnings: Taking a Look at Key Metrics Versus Estimates
ZACKS· 2025-08-08 15:01
Core Insights - SurModics reported revenue of $29.57 million for the quarter ended June 2025, a decrease of 2.6% year-over-year, but exceeded the Zacks Consensus Estimate by 4.29% [1] - The company achieved an EPS of $0.06, a significant improvement from -$0.27 in the same quarter last year, resulting in an EPS surprise of 128.57% compared to the consensus estimate of -$0.21 [1] Revenue Breakdown - Product sales amounted to $16.76 million, surpassing the average estimate of $15.69 million, but reflecting a year-over-year decline of 4.6% [4] - Revenue from research, development, and other sources was $3.15 million, exceeding the average estimate of $2.37 million, marking a year-over-year increase of 35.7% [4] - Royalties and license fees generated $9.66 million, slightly below the estimated $10.2 million, representing a year-over-year decrease of 7.7% [4] Stock Performance - SurModics shares have returned +12.9% over the past month, outperforming the Zacks S&P 500 composite's +1.9% change [3] - The stock currently holds a Zacks Rank 5 (Strong Sell), indicating potential underperformance relative to the broader market in the near term [3]
